Type
ORACLE
Validation date
2025-10-13 16:58: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 3.312e-4,
    "usd": 3.834e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000127B573796F635C40C3D1DCE8164E3B4A1E506AA0984853D6A671C533A8D1BFF1

Previous signature

FB06FD75DFC4CCB40EBB7B9B73F498EC13D59633DA1104E47D80902C0D92312342A590E586A018F149ABEC6E1C4D401BC724DB67DAF8E13BC01177C0A5B4F903

Origin signature

3046022100E51AB0377926E91AA1EAE6D459A1BFF4EF5A6B269795A9BC5F3D53DC6CB0DCE8022100B956BA0D92DD9739252ED99E0B2B584F3F3800B48E8A9EA968831B1AB884FF12

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

003A735CCEAD980EF4BA6B8FDD5FC46A09F166F872FC584A01C69CCA504B5607F2

Coordinator signature

546342C11F6793A51F7E7CE24B6C99328A1805548F7E6265A3BE5A6D0B5F1F3210E8983C6AE79AB6E0B95DB70B9DF83D6C53C70DC7BBB7407C7113A221D94404

Validator #1 public key

0001581C16262AD57CB624ECED9BBFD952C50E3B2A03B3E4DBCBB0B4141A989DBD92

Validator #1 signature

8E82B09EA19C1457A8984B90EF0A2CD1B4EA830FECA5A8C5C4D0FC3A12F96B86348DB7FAF71DC738E770853A7C4D4A4F60CFDE026081E889C1DF8BBF8D0BD301

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

23CF3C2069511F23911268E67223557A2887C48EF1606B25A012BED7519BF41CAAF282D7F177B49D21480394B8EBDA582BEC44DDF9F542070A8BE60AD3E1BD0B